3.1: Sundance Film Festival: Native American and Indigenous Film Program

Website: Native American and Indigenous Film Program 

Sundance was initially founded by American filmmaker Robert Redford, who wanted to ensure that indigenous filmmakers were given voice at the festival. Since 1981, the Sundance institute has supported 300 indigenous artists through grants, mentorships, and the platform of the film festival. This page contains a six minute video on the topic of the Sundance Institute’s Native American and Indigenous Film Program with interview clips of many indigenous filmmakers. Filmmaker Ty Sanga remarks  “film has become that new evolution to not only express who we are but also preserve our culture.
